1. What Are Crypto Payments?

Crypto payments are digital transactions where customers use cryptocurrencies instead of cash or credit cards. These payments happen on blockchain networks, ensuring transparency, security, and speed.

Popular coins used for payments include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and USDT (Tether) — each offering fast and borderless transactions.

2. Why Businesses Are Embracing Crypto Payments

In 2025, crypto adoption is growing rapidly due to several benefits:

  • Low Transaction Fees: No more 2–3% credit card cuts.

  • Global Access: Accept payments from any country, instantly.

  • Faster Processing: Blockchain payments confirm within minutes.

  • Enhanced Security: Immutable records reduce chargeback risks.

  • New Customers: Attract crypto users who prefer digital currencies.

Accepting crypto can help businesses stay competitive and expand globally without middlemen.

3. How to Accept Bitcoin and Other Cryptocurrencies

Setting up crypto payments is easier than it sounds. Here’s a simple breakdown:

Step 1: Choose a Crypto Payment Processor

Use reliable platforms like Coinbase Commerce, BitPay, or CoinPayments to accept Bitcoin and convert it into fiat currency automatically.

Step 2: Set Up a Digital Wallet

Create a crypto wallet to store your funds safely. Hardware wallets like Ledger and Trezor offer top-tier security.

Step 3: Add Crypto Checkout Options to Your Website

Integrate crypto payment buttons or plugins for platforms like WooCommerce, Shopify, or WordPress.

Step 4: Display Accepted Cryptos

Show your customers you accept Bitcoin, Ethereum, or stablecoins. Transparency boosts trust.

Step 5: Stay Compliant and Track Taxes

Keep records of every transaction. Many countries now require businesses to report crypto earnings for taxation.

4. Best Tools for Crypto Payments in 2025

Tool/Service Main Feature Ideal For
BitPay Converts crypto to fiat instantly eCommerce & retail
Coinbase Commerce Easy setup and high security Online businesses
NOWPayments Multi-coin support Global brands
BTCPay Server 100% open-source Tech-savvy users
CoinGate Accepts 70+ cryptocurrencies International merchants

These tools make it possible to accept digital currencies without deep technical knowledge.

5. Security Tips for Businesses Accepting Crypto

While crypto offers strong encryption, it’s essential to follow security best practices:

  • Use two-factor authentication (2FA) for wallets and accounts.

  • Store large funds in cold wallets (offline).

  • Update software and security patches regularly.

  • Educate your staff on phishing and scam prevention.

Remember: Blockchain is secure, but human mistakes aren’t.

6. Should You Hold or Convert Your Crypto?

Businesses can either:

  • Convert crypto to fiat immediately to avoid volatility, or

  • Hold crypto as an investment if they believe in long-term value.

Many payment processors allow auto-conversion, giving you flexibility depending on your risk tolerance.
